A Computerized Drug Delivery Control System for Regulation of Blood Pressure

چکیده

Many patients presenting hypertension before/after surgery should need to receive adequate medication. For example, patients with dissecting aneurysm often show extreme hypertension and an adequate control of blood pressure of the patient will lead to good surgical outcome. On the other hand, untreated hypertension after surgery may create complication. Therefore, hypertension control after/before surgery is important. In this paper, postsurgical hypertension control for cardiac patients, without loss of generality, will be focused. From the past experience, elevated blood pressure often occurs in the early hours following open-heart surgery. Basically, there are several medications such as Sodium Nitroprusside (SNP) and Nitroglycerin, etc., which are commonly used for the treatment of postsurgical hypertension of the cardiac patient. We consider here Sodium Nitroprusside in the design of the control system. However, due to a wide range of patients’ drug sensitivities to SNP, manual control by clinical personnel could be very tedious, time consuming and inconsistent. An automatic drug delivery controller based on feedback method may quickly reduce the oscillatory change in mean blood pressure through infusion of SNP. In this paper, an adaptive Proportional-Integral (PI) control of mean blood pressure using SNP is presented. A new algorithm updating variations in time delay and sensitivity of the system is proposed and its effectiveness in the treatment of the hypertension patient is discussed. For demonstration, simulations under clinical conditions are carried out.
